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Patti to Bari is to bus which costs €35 - €55 and takes 9h 47m.
The fastest way to get from Patti to Bari is to shuttle and fly which takes 4h 54m and costs €80 - €190.
No, there is no direct bus from Patti to Bari. However, there are services departing from Patti and arriving at Bari Viale Unità d'Italia via Messina - Piazza della Repubblica and Taranto Porto Mercantile.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 47m.
The distance between Patti and Bari is 591 km.
